While it may be your best option, chemotherapy can come with its own set of struggles and side effects. Chemotherapy can cause a wide range of issues that interfere with healthy eating. Things like alterations to your appetite and your sense or taste and smell. You may experience diarrhea or constipation, severe weight loss or gain, and/or pains from dry mouth or mouth sores. Nausea is also a common side effect that can get in the way of maintaining a healthy diet. This is especially problematic because being well fed with healthy food is imperative to your overall health as your body needs energy to fight off the cancer and any other ailments.
